What Return Air Ducts Accumulate Over Time in Sandy, OR

Heavy Dust and Debris From Room Air in Sandy

Return ducts draw room air containing everything suspended in it through the return grilles and duct runs with every HVAC cycle in Sandy, OR. The fine dust from household activity, fabric fiber from furniture and carpets, skin cells from occupants, and general household particulate all travel in the return airstream in Sandy. Over years of accumulation, the return duct surfaces develop a significantly thicker and denser layer of debris than supply duct surfaces in most residential systems in Sandy, OR.

Pet Hair and Dander at Higher Concentrations in Sandy, OR

In households with pets, return grilles and the return duct sections immediately behind them accumulate pet hair and dander at a rate significantly higher than supply ducts in Sandy. Pet hair is drawn toward the return grilles by the return airstream and accumulates on the grille faces and in the duct channels behind them in Sandy, OR. The return side of systems in pet-owning households requires more frequent cleaning than systems without pets in Sandy.

Mold Where Moisture Has Been Present in Sandy

Return ducts in areas with elevated humidity or near moisture sources can develop mold growth on their interior surfaces in Sandy, OR. Mold on return duct surfaces is distributed by the return airstream toward the air handler and into the supply side with every HVAC cycle in Sandy.

Grease Particles in Return Ducts Near Kitchens in Sandy, OR

Return ducts in or near kitchen spaces draw cooking-generated grease particles and cooking odors from the kitchen air in Sandy. Grease particles in the return airstream deposit as a sticky layer on return duct surfaces near kitchen return grilles in Sandy, OR. This grease layer accumulates dust and debris more aggressively than clean duct surfaces and becomes progressively more restrictive over time in Sandy.

Construction Debris in Homes With Recent Work in Sandy

Return grilles in rooms where construction or renovation work occurred draw construction debris from the room air into the return system in Sandy, OR. Drywall dust, wood dust, and construction particulate drawn through return grilles during or after construction accumulates in the return duct sections in Sandy. In homes where renovation occurred with the HVAC system operating, the return side typically accumulates a heavy construction debris load in Sandy, OR.

How a Dirty Return Side Affects the Complete HVAC System in Sandy, OR

How Return Restriction Affects the Whole System Airflow in Sandy

The HVAC system's airflow is a closed loop in Sandy, OR. Restriction on the return side reduces the volume of air the blower can pull through the system per unit of time in Sandy. The reduced intake directly reduces the supply side delivery because the blower can only push as much air into the supply side as it is pulling through the return side in Sandy, OR. Return restriction reduces airflow throughout the complete system in Sandy.

What Bypassed Contamination Does to the Air Handler in Sandy, OR

Contamination shedding from return duct surfaces into the return airstream bypasses the filter if the filter is positioned at the air handler rather than at the return grilles in Sandy. This contamination enters the air handler directly and accumulates on the blower wheel, the coil surfaces, and the cabinet interior in Sandy, OR. On the coil, it reduces heat transfer and can contribute to microbial growth on the moist coil surface in Sandy.

How Return Contamination Reduces Filter Effectiveness in Sandy

A heavily contaminated return duct system sheds particles into the return airstream that increase the particle load the filter has to capture in Sandy, OR. The filter reaches its rated capacity and requires replacement more frequently than it would with a clean return duct system in Sandy. A filter that loads quickly becomes a restriction source itself when it is not replaced frequently enough in Sandy, OR.

The Energy Cost of a Restricted Return System in Sandy, OR

A blower working against a restricted return runs harder and longer per cycle than a blower with clean, unobstructed return ducts in Sandy. The motor draws more electrical energy per unit of air moved in Sandy, OR. The system reaches setpoint more slowly because it is moving less total air volume per cycle in Sandy. Every billing cycle with a restricted return side reflects these efficiency losses in Sandy, OR.
